What weight should I choose for a Medicine Ball?
To choose the right weight for your wall ball, you need to take into account your level of fitness, your body size and the type of exercise you're aiming for:
- Choose a ball between 4 and 6 kg if you want to perform long but fast sets such as AMRAP. This weight is particularly suitable for beginners. It's also the ideal weight range for women.
- Choose a 6-9 kg Medicine Ball if you're at a more advanced level, or if you're a man. This is the weight designed for the more intensive training often applied in crosstraining.
- Go for a ball weighing over 10 kg if you're at a more advanced level.

What exercises can I do with a weighted ball?
The wall ball shot, a crosstraining classic:
- Hold your ball at face level, with both hands in support.
- Stand with your feet shoulder-width apart.
- Do a squat, keeping your back straight and the ball at the same height.
- Push off with your legs, throwing the ball against a wall above you.
- Catch the ball by flexing into a squat at the same time.
There are many other exercises you can do with a weighted ball, such as the russian twist, the wall throw, or crunching on the floor with a partner in front of you, to whom you throw the medicine ball as you come up.
Example of a training session
For an effective workout with a Medicine Ball, try this series of exercises:
- Wall Ball Shots: 3 sets of 15 repetitions to develop power and explosiveness.
- Russian Twists: 3 sets of 20 repetitions (10 on each side) to strengthen the obliques.
- Squats with Medicine Ball: 3 sets of 12 repetitions for overall muscle strengthening.
- Slam Ball: 3 sets of 10 repetitions for explosiveness and coordination.
Adapt the weights and number of repetitions to your level for targeted, effective training.
